Music
Hubbard Hall is a remarkable place to hear music. The space is intimate (the small hall seats only 150 people), the acoustics are wonderful, and the audience is always lively and attentive. The three foundations of our music program are: Hubbard Hall Opera TheaterBuilding off of the rich tradition of arts in the Cambridge Valley, Hubbard Hall Opera Theater seeks to bring yet another element of culture to an already bustling center. The mission of HHOT is to provide classically trained singers and instrumentalists in New England and upstate New York greater opportunities to create something beautiful close to home, while also giving rural audiences the chance to enjoy an opera without having to spend the night in a city to do so. HHOT plunges into its first season with a production of Mozart’s La scuola degli amanti (The School for Lovers), better known as Cosi fan tutte (All Women Do It). This opera is famous for some of the genres’ greatest ensemble works and pairs Mozart’s quintessentially vibrant music with the libretto of his best collaborator, Lorenzo Da Ponte. The plot is rooted in a cynical comedy of errors wherein each character is destined to expose infidelity in all its guises. With gambols and ruses Cosi fan tutte presents the limits and shortcomings of all relationships with a sardonic humor in a way that is still socially relevant and would make any young lover cringe, laugh at himself (or herself), and then hopefully take the lesson home. As in the origins of the theater, the Hall will host a twenty piece orchestra to complement six Divas and Divos who will bring a taste of Italian melodrama to the forests and fields of Cambridge, NY. Community MusicThis includes cabarets performed by members of the Theatre Company at Hubbard Hall, local musicians and singers such as Lo Faber, Todd Pasternack (marlow), Art Lande, Bruce Williamson and pianist Richard Cherry, and performers with family or friend connections to the area (Sigard Rascher, the father of the classical saxophone, lived in the area, and when the Rascher Quartet from Germany has been on US tours, they often stopped for a concert in Hubbard Hall). |
